What Does a Magenta Aura Mean?
A magenta aura is one of the rarest and most extraordinary energy signatures encountered in aura photography. When the AuraCam 6000 biofeedback sensors register a magenta-dominant electromagnetic field, it reveals an individual whose energy operates beyond conventional boundaries — someone who synthesizes the grounded passion of red with the transcendent intuition of violet into something entirely their own. Magenta does not exist on the traditional visible light spectrum as a single wavelength; it is a perceptual phenomenon created by the brain when red and violet frequencies combine, making it a fitting signature for people who exist between worlds, bridging the physical and the ethereal in ways that resist easy categorization.
Individuals who radiate a magenta aura are the true nonconformists of the energetic spectrum. They do not rebel for rebellion's sake — their deviation from the mainstream arises from a genuine inability to fit within structures that feel inauthentic to their core nature. These are visionaries who perceive reality through a lens that most people never access, noticing beauty in the overlooked, possibility in the discarded, and meaning in the absurd. Their creative output tends to be ahead of its time, often misunderstood initially but recognized as prescient in hindsight.

The Magenta Aura Personality
Magenta aura individuals are fiercely original souls who move through the world with a rare combination of creative vision and emotional depth. They are not interested in fitting in — not because they are contrarian, but because their inner compass points toward territories that mainstream culture has not yet mapped. Their magnetism is undeniable; people are drawn to their authenticity and the quiet confidence with which they inhabit their uniqueness. They see the world differently, and they have the courage to live according to what they see rather than what they are told. This makes them both inspiring and occasionally bewildering to those around them — a paradox they have long since made peace with.

Magenta Aura & the Soul Star Chakra
The magenta aura is associated with the Soul Star chakra, an energy center located approximately six inches above the crown of the head. Sometimes called the eighth chakra, the Soul Star transcends the traditional seven-chakra system and governs our connection to higher consciousness, soul purpose, and the aspects of identity that exist beyond a single lifetime. When the Soul Star chakra is active and balanced, it produces the luminous, otherworldly energy that defines the magenta aura — a sense of being fully human while simultaneously connected to something vast and ineffable. This is the chakra of the mystic, the avant-garde artist, and the spiritual pioneer.
